help!!!!
my pc has some sort of re-direct wotsit on it
every time i click on certain web address's (clean ones before you say anything) i get re-directed to random websites.
i run internet explorer 7
i've got norton anti virus2006 installed and running correctly
when i click on a link at the bottom left of the screen it says
waiting for jupk.com then it sends me to a random website some ****, some random stuff like paragliding near manchester
i've run norton spyware scan and the anti virus but these show nothing up.
i've deleted all cookies etc
where or how do i get rid of this.

Try this:
Start
Control Panel
Network Connections
Right-click LAN / Internet Connection -> properties
Internet Protocol (TCP/IP) -> properties
Select "Obtain DNS Server address automatically"
Click OK
It should be ok now
